Impacts of Rain on Roofing



Rain can be a quiet adversary to your roofing system, creating both prompt and long-term damage. When water leaks into cracks or gaps, it can lead to leaks, which might not show up immediately. You could observe a discolor on your ceiling, yet by then, the wetness could have already endangered your roofing structure.



Over time, constant exposure to rainfall can compromise roof covering materials. Tiles might warp, curl, and even break down, leaving your home vulnerable to additional water breach. Mold and mold thrive in moist conditions, which can compromise your interior air quality and cause wellness problems.

Standing water on your roof covering can also cause serious problems. It adds unnecessary weight, raising the threat of architectural failure. Plus, it can accelerate the degeneration of your roofing products, making replacements extra frequent and costly.

To shield your roofing, ensure your rain gutters are clean and working properly to draw away rain away. Routine assessments can help you capture potential problems before they intensify.

Taking these steps now can save you money and time in the future, maintaining your home safe and completely dry.

Influence of Snow and Ice



When winter season gets here, snow and ice can present significant risks to your roofing system, just like rainfall. Ice can also cause issues, particularly with ice dams. When snow on your roof melts, it can flow down and refreeze at the eaves, producing a dam that prevents correct water drainage. Water then supports under roof shingles, leading to leaks and water damages inside your home.

To protect your roofing system, it's essential to keep rain gutters free from debris, enabling appropriate water drainage. Frequently examining your roofing system for indicators of wear and damages can help capture problems early.

If you see a significant quantity of snow, think about working with a professional to eliminate it safely. Bear in mind, it's much better to be proactive concerning snow and ice than to manage costly repair work later. Taking these actions can aid guarantee your roofing endures the winter season without major problems.

Sunshine and Temperature Level Challenges



While you might appreciate bright days, extended direct exposure to sunshine and severe temperatures can be harmful to your roofing system. UV rays can break down roofing products over time, bring about warping, cracking, or fading. If your roof's tiles are made from asphalt, they may end up being breakable under extreme heat, making them much more susceptible to damages.

In addition, heats can increase the threat of thermal development. As materials expand during the heat of the day and agreement at night, this continuous cycle can produce stress and anxiety on your roof, possibly triggering leaks or various other architectural problems.

You might likewise discover raised energy prices as your cooling system functions harder to battle heat buildup in your attic room.

It's important to pick roofing products that can withstand your regional climate's temperature variations. Light-colored or reflective roofing can help in reducing heat absorption, while appropriate ventilation in your attic room can keep a balanced temperature.

Normal examinations and maintenance can also capture troubles early, guaranteeing your roofing stays in optimal condition. By remaining positive, you'll protect your investment and expand your roofing's life-span despite the obstacles posed by sunshine and temperature extremes.
